Paragon Laboratories is a leading contract manufacturer of Dietary Supplements in tablet, capsule, and powder forms. For over 50 years, Paragon’s top-notch formulators and manufacturing personnel have been improving lives by delivering quality nutritional supplements. We are located in Torrance, California, are an Equal Opportunity Employer, and seek an experienced Director of Supply Chain for immediate hire. This is an exciting opportunity to join a growing manufacturing company that distributes globally.




Job Summary:

The Director of Supply Chain reports to the COO and will plan, direct, coordinate, and oversee operations activities in the organization, manage the development and implementation of efficient operations and cost-effective systems, and build processes that guarantee the efficient movement and storage of raw materials, work-in-process inventory, and of finished goods from point of origin to point of consumption.


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Lead, develop, manage, and grow all aspects of a Supply Chain consisting of Sourcing, Demand and Supply Planning, Procurement, Contract Manufacturing communication, Distribution, and Logistics teams that will deliver in a fast-paced growing environment.

  • Define and implement comprehensive strategies for all aspects of the company’s supply chain to reduce costs, mitigate risk, improve quality, shorten lead times and reduce inventories.

  • Provide exceptional leadership to Supply Chain teams.

  • Create structure, hire/train staff, develop personnel, give direction, integrate/leverage global capabilities, and hold team members accountable.

  • Oversee demand forecasting, supply planning, and procurement to ensure resource requirements are satisfied.

  • Collaborate with the Sales, Sales Operations, Shipping, and Receiving departments to establish policies and procedures that ensure orders contain all pertinent information required for accurate vendor orders and deliveries.

  • Ensure a high level of collaboration and customer service is provided to internal customers.

  • On-going management of supplier relationships, cost negotiations and management, terms and conditions, and all other logistical requirements.

  • Ensure that supply chain costs, inventory, and delivery performance targets are met.

  • Resolve issues with vendors, purchase orders, and receipts.

  • Provide strategic consulting and analytic perspective to executive management on strategies, opportunities, and risks.

  • Team with Procurement, QA, and R&D, to seek out and evaluate new manufacturing capabilities consistent with early-stage product development.


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s and/or Master’s degree in Business/Administration, Engineering, MBA, Operations Management, or Supply Chain Management.

  • 5+ years of progressive experience in contract manufacturing, logistics, supply and demand planning, procurement, and hands-on leadership roles in a GMP environment are a must.

  • Strategic thinker with demonstrated ability to envision the future state of the business and synthesize facts and insights into concrete, actionable, strategies and plans.

  • Ability to build and develop teams set high standards, and lead others to action.

  • Strong problem-solving skills; with the ability to be a decision maker as well as a contributor.

  • Self-directed with a demonstrated sense of accountability.

  • Versed in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P) and other regulatory requirements.
